Louis Vuitton: The Symbol of Timeless Craftsmanship
Louis Vuitton built its name on perfecting the art of travel, and that focus on durability and classic style remains at its core. Best known for its iconic LV monogram canvas on handbags and luggage, the brand represents a blend of heritage and modernity. It appeals to a wide audience of affluent consumers who want exceptional quality and a recognized symbol of prestige without being overtly trendy.
- Product mix: Famous for its wide range of iconic handbags in various sizes like the Speedy, Neverfull, and Alma. Also offers an extensive collection of luggage, accessories, shoes, and ready-to-wear fashion.
- Price point: Handbags generally range from $1,200 to $5,000, while smaller accessories and leather goods start around $300. Pricing is premium but often more accessible than Chanel for an entry-level piece.
- Quality: The brand's coated canvas is famously durable and stands up to daily wear remarkably well. Its leather goods and expert craftsmanship ensure products last for generations, and they offer extensive repair services.
- Style: The aesthetic is both classic and minimalist. While the monogram is instantly recognizable, the shapes and silhouettes are often versatile and designed for both formal and casual use.
Choose Louis Vuitton for durable, versatile pieces with strong brand heritage that easily transition through seasons and occasions.

Gucci: The Eclectic Trendsetter
Gucci stands out for its bold, eclectic, and unapologetically modern approach to luxury. Under its creative direction, the brand embraces a mix of vintage inspiration, streetwear energy, and vibrant patterns. Gucci attracts a diverse and often younger demographic that values personal expression, individuality, and being at the forefront of fashion trends.
- Product mix: Its range is diverse, including highly sought-after handbags, shoes like the iconic loafers, ready-to-wear fashion, eyewear, and bold accessories. Everything features the brand's distinctive logos and motifs.
- Price point: Luxury pricing with handbags typically falling between $1,000 and $4,000. Shoes and accessories can start from $300 up to $2,500, positioning it competitively with Louis Vuitton.
- Quality: Employs a variety of high-quality materials, from classic leathers and canvas to more innovative textiles. While the quality is high, the focus is often on design and aesthetic innovation.
- Style: Bold, edgy, and youthful. The brand is known for its maximalist designs, frequent use of logos, animal motifs, and vibrant color palettes that make an immediate statement.
Gucci is the brand for the fashion-forward individual who isn't afraid to take risks and wants their luxury to reflect contemporary culture.

Chanel: The Epitome of Understated Elegance
Chanel is the definition of timeless elegance. From its legendary Chanel No. 5 fragrance to the iconic 2.55 handbag, the brand exudes a level of sophistication and refined femininity that is unmatched. With a history of haute couture, its aesthetic is defined by clean lines, exceptional craftsmanship, and iconic elements like tweed and quilted leather.
- Product mix: Best known for classic handbags like the Classic Flap and the 2.55, Chanel also offers haute couture, ready-to-wear, fine jewelry, and cosmetics. They severely limit product availability online to maintain exclusivity.
- Price point: Chanel sits at the highest end of the luxury market. Classic handbags start around $5,000 and can easily exceed $10,000, with prices regularly increasing each year, positioning them as investment assets.
- Quality: Synonymous with superior craftsmanship. The use of fine leathers, perfect quilting, and meticulous finishing details make its handbags revered for their long-lasting quality and timeless appeal.
- Style: Understated, classic, and refined. The elegance of a Chanel piece comes from its simple lines and perfect execution rather than bold branding.
Chanel is for the luxury connoisseur who values heritage, prefers timeless design over trends, and sees their purchases as long-term investments.

Louis Vuitton vs. Gucci vs. Chanel Comparison
Price & Exclusivity
Chanel is unequivocally the most expensive and exclusive of the three. With handbag prices starting near five figures and consistent annual price increases, owning a Chanel piece is a significant financial investment. This creates a powerful aura of exclusivity, as its key items are available only in boutiques.
Louis Vuitton and Gucci occupy a similar price bracket just below Chanel, making them more accessible entry points into high luxury. Gucci's more frequent promotional campaigns and wide product variety can sometimes make it feel slightly more attainable, while Louis Vuitton holds its pricing firm, cultivating exclusivity through controlled supply and classic appeal.
Quality & Materials
All three brands boast exceptional quality, but their strengths differ. Chanel is often considered the peak of fine handbag craftsmanship, famous for its luxurious lambskin and caviar leathers and perfect, detailed stitching.
Louis Vuitton's reputation is built on durability. Its coated canvas is legendary for its ability to withstand scratches, water, and daily abuse, making LV bags highly practical for everyday use. Its Vachetta leather develops a beautiful patina over time, a signature of a well-loved piece.
Gucci uses high-quality materials across its varied collections, from its GG Supreme canvas to fine Italian leathers. Because its designs are often more complex and fashion-focused, the construction may prioritize aesthetic impact alongside durability.
Style & Aesthetic
This is the clearest point of difference. Gucci is the trendsetter, it lives in the now with bold, eclectic, logo-heavy designs that align with current streetwear and vintage trends. Its look is vibrant, daring, and youthful.
Chanel is the embodiment of timelessness. Its designs, like the Classic Flap bag or tweed jacket, look as elegant today as they did decades ago. The aesthetic is sophisticated, understated, and quintessentially feminine, avoiding trends in favor of enduring style.
Louis Vuitton masterfully balances the classic and contemporary. The LV monogram is a timeless status symbol, but its collaborations with artists keep the brand feeling fresh. Its silhouettes are clean and versatile, making them a safe yet sophisticated choice for almost anyone.
Shopping Experience
The shopping experience at each brand is tailored to its identity. A Louis Vuitton store offers a classic, welcoming luxury experience with attentive and personalized service. Their online store is robust and easy to navigate.
Gucci boutiques are trendy and modern, designed to be an immersive brand experience that feels exciting and engages a digital-native audience. The online experience is similarly creative and engaging.
Shopping at a Chanel boutique is an exclusive, high-touch affair. For many top items like handbags, it is the only way to purchase new. The service is discreet and highly personalized, reinforcing the brand's top-tier positioning.

Frequently Asked Questions
Which brand is the most expensive?
Chanel is the most expensive by a significant margin. Its classic handbags often double the price of comparable entry-level bags from Louis Vuitton or Gucci, with frequent price increases solidifying its top-tier status.
Which brand holds its value best?
Chanel, particularly its classic handbag styles like the Classic Flap and 2.55, are known for holding and often increasing their value on the resale market, making them a very strong investment. Many classic Louis Vuitton bags also have excellent resale value due to their durability and timeless appeal.
Do any of these brands go on sale?
No. None of these three brands hold traditional sales for their leather goods or classic items. Exclusivity is a key part of their strategy, and discounting products would undermine that approach.
Which brand has the best quality?
All three offer exceptional quality, but they excel in different areas. Chanel is celebrated for its meticulous stitching and use of fine, delicate leathers. Louis Vuitton is a benchmark for durability and practical luxury. Gucci offers high-quality craftsmanship with a focus on innovative designs and materials.
Which brand is most popular right now?
Gucci often leads in generating cultural buzz and capturing the attention of social media and younger consumers with its trend-forward collaborations and collections. However, Louis Vuitton and Chanel remain consistently in demand among dedicated luxury buyers.
Can you buy these brands online?
Yes, you can buy most items from Louis Vuitton's and Gucci's official websites. Chanel, however, maintains its exclusivity by primarily selling its most famous products, like handbags, only within its physical boutiques.
Which brand came first?
Louis Vuitton is the oldest, founded in 1854 as a maker of luxury trunks. Chanel was founded in 1910, and Gucci was founded in 1921.
What is the most iconic bag from each brand?
For Louis Vuitton, it's arguably the Speedy or the Neverfull tote. For Gucci, popular styles include the Dionysus or Jackie 1961. For Chanel, it would be the iconic Classic Flap bag.
